About

Fan Zhong is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Spectroscopy and Cancer Research. According to data from OpenAlex, Fan Zhong has authored 57 papers receiving a total of 2.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 39 papers in Molecular Biology, 7 papers in Spectroscopy and 6 papers in Cancer Research. Recurrent topics in Fan Zhong’s work include Advanced Proteomics Techniques and Applications (7 papers), Bioinformatics and Genomic Networks (6 papers) and Ubiquitin and proteasome pathways (6 papers). Fan Zhong is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Proteomics Techniques and Applications (7 papers), Bioinformatics and Genomic Networks (6 papers) and Ubiquitin and proteasome pathways (6 papers). Fan Zhong coll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Finland. Fan Zhong's co-authors include Jussi Taipale, Eevi Kaasinen, Jian Yan, Kashyap Dave, Biswajyoti Sahu, Arttu Jolma, Teemu Kivioja, Fuchu He, Minna Taipale and Kazuhiro R. Nitta and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Nature Biotechnology and Bioinformatics.
